    You can download your drivers from ECS. They made the motherboard for HP. Here's a link:
    http://www.ecs.com.tw/ECSWebSite/Pr...egoryID=1&DetailName=Driver&MenuID=44&LanID=0
    Install the chipset drivers first (also called the Intel Inf) and reboot. Then click this link to download the UAA HD audio driver (KB888111). Install it. Then install the audio and the rest of the drivers. It is VERY important to install the chipset Inf FIRST and the UAA drivers SECOND. If you try to install the sound before the chipset and/or the UAA, you'll run into massive problems getting the sound to work.

    (next time you decide to dump Vista and go back to XP, try to locate the drivers B E F O R E you start installing XP! There have been cases where NO drivers for XP were available. NONE. So the user had to go back to Vista.)
